It reads so clearly and honestly, and I admire its unusual, dynamic perspective on familiar archetypes.Measuring approximately 4 ¾ x 2 ¾ inches, the cards of the Vampyre Tarot feature a thin black border around the illustrations and an ornate stonework banner at the bottom. The Major Arcana lacks numbering and the Minor suits follow the designation of Knives (Swords), Scepters (Wands), Grails (Cups) and Skulls (Pentacles). The almost-but-not-quite reversible backings depict thorny, intertwined branches with a red rose in the middle, and the background looks to be blood-spattered stone (a grave marker, perhaps?).It would be enough to own this lavish deck, but the Phantasmagoria book is (far) beyond most deck companions. This is Hands-Down my favorite deck!The Tarot of Vampyres is a tarot deck and book set heavily inspired by the symbolism of the Thoth tarot. It is laden with symbols and rich imagery that provide a complete picture of the matters the seeker is asking about.Ian Daniels is an amazing artist with a new project in the wings. His artwork is phenomenal and there is only one card in this deck that I'm not partial to (the nine of grails) because the appearance of the woman is particularly uncomfortable for me.This is a DARK DECK, and its symbolism is deep and connected with the Golden Dawn traditions and Alistair Crowley's writings. Seekers should be aware that this is NOT a RWS (Rider-Waite-Smith) deck and that everything from the images to the symbols have a much darker feel to them. As Mr. Daniels writes in his amazing book Phantasmagoria (accompanying the deck), the purpose of these cards is to draw out the darker parts of ourselves and to reveal the hidden parts of our nature.As a result, I feel that this deck does an outstanding job of offering good, relevant advice to the seeker. No deck has ever spoken to me more than this deck, and I highly recommend it for those who are interested in working with darker symbolism and imagery, as well as committed enough to explore the underlying astrology and numerology of this deck.Some things you may wish to note:Card stock is relatively thin. I didn't like this at first but later realized that it makes the cards easier to handle for me. The stock is NOT cheap, though it is THIN. This is something to bear in mind, compared to other decks.Cards do not come with a storage box. They will come cellophane-wrapped inside of a much larger box inside a box. You'll need to get some kind of storage box or bag for your cards. Please don't rubber band them.The accompanying book is the best I've ever received with a deck of tarot cards and provides amply study opportunities with the deck. However, it does not provide illustrations of the cards, either black and white or in color, and some users have been upset about this.
